1. Understanding OBD2 and Its Importance
1.1 What is OBD2?
On-Board Diagnostics II (OBD2) is a standardized system used in most vehicles since 1996 to monitor engine performance, emissions, and other critical systems. According to the Environmental Protection Agency (EPA), OBD2 was implemented to ensure vehicles meet emissions standards.
1.2 Why is OBD2 Important?
OBD2 provides valuable insights into your car’s health. It can:
- Detect issues early, preventing costly repairs.
- Help you understand why your check engine light is on.
- Monitor fuel efficiency and driving habits.
- Ensure your car meets emissions standards.
1.3 How Does OBD2 Work?
OBD2 works by using sensors to monitor various parameters within the engine and other systems. When a problem is detected, the system stores a Diagnostic Trouble Code (DTC), which can be read using an OBD2 scanner or app. This data helps mechanics diagnose and repair issues more efficiently.
2. Key Features to Look for in an OBD2 App Free
2.1 Basic Diagnostic Functions
A good OBD2 app free should offer essential diagnostic functions, including:
- Reading and clearing Diagnostic Trouble Codes (DTCs)
- Viewing freeze frame data (sensor data when a DTC was stored)
- Accessing live sensor data (e.g., engine RPM, coolant temperature)
2.2 Enhanced Features
Look for apps that offer enhanced features such as:
- Customizable dashboards
- Performance monitoring (e.g., 0-60 mph times)
- Fuel efficiency tracking
- Support for extended PIDs (manufacturer-specific data)
2.3 Compatibility and Ease of Use
The app should be compatible with your smartphone (iOS or Android) and easy to navigate. It should also support a wide range of OBD2 adapters and protocols.
2.4 Data Logging and Exporting
The ability to log sensor data and export it for further analysis can be invaluable for diagnosing intermittent issues or tracking performance over time.
2.5 Free vs. Paid Versions
Many OBD2 apps offer a free version with basic features and a paid version with advanced capabilities. Consider your needs and budget when choosing an app.
3. Top OBD2 App Free Choices for iOS and Android
3.1 Car Scanner ELM OBD2
Car Scanner ELM OBD2 offers a wide range of features for free, including:
- Customizable dashboards
- DTC reading and clearing
- Live sensor data
- Connection profiles for various car brands (Toyota, Mitsubishi, GM, etc.)
- HUD mode for projecting data onto your windshield
The app is compatible with most OBD2-compliant vehicles and supports ELM327 adapters. However, some advanced features may require a one-time purchase or subscription.
3.2 Torque Lite (Android)
Torque Lite is a popular choice for Android users, offering:
- Real-time OBD2 sensor data
- DTC fault code reading
- Dyno / Dynomometer and Horsepower/Torque
- Customizable dashboards
The app supports a wide range of vehicles and adapters. Torque Pro, the paid version, unlocks additional features such as data logging and enhanced PIDs.
3.3 OBD Auto Doctor
OBD Auto Doctor is a comprehensive OBD2 app available for both iOS and Android. It provides:
- Diagnostic trouble codes reading
- Clear trouble codes and reset the MIL (“Check Engine” light)
- Readiness monitor status
- OBD-II parameter IDs (PIDs)
- Fuel consumption monitoring
The app also offers a paid version with advanced features like enhanced diagnostics and data logging.
3.4 Dr. Prius / Dr. Hybrid
Specifically designed for Toyota and Lexus hybrid vehicles, Dr. Prius / Dr. Hybrid offers unique features such as:
- Hybrid battery health check
- Inverter temperature monitoring
- Active test functions
This app can help hybrid owners diagnose and maintain their vehicles more effectively.
3.5 EOBD Facile
EOBD Facile is another versatile OBD2 app that works on both iOS and Android platforms. Its key features include:
- Reading and clearing fault codes
- Displaying real-time sensors
- Recording trips
- Exporting data in CSV format
The paid version offers enhanced diagnostics and access to a larger database of DTC definitions.

5. Connecting Your OBD2 Adapter to Your Smartphone
5.1 Types of OBD2 Adapters
OBD2 adapters come in two main types:
- Bluetooth: Connects wirelessly to your smartphone via Bluetooth.
- Wi-Fi: Connects wirelessly to your smartphone via Wi-Fi.
Bluetooth adapters are generally easier to set up, while Wi-Fi adapters may offer faster data transfer rates.
5.2 Adapter Recommendations
Recommended adapter brands include:
- Kiwi 3
- Viecar
- V-Gate
- Carista
- LELink
- Veepeak
Avoid cheap Chinese adapters marked as v.2.1, as they may have bugs and connectivity issues.
5.3 Setup Process
- Plug the OBD2 adapter into the OBD2 port in your car (usually located under the dashboard).
- Turn on your car’s ignition (but you don’t need to start the engine).
- On your smartphone, enable Bluetooth or Wi-Fi and search for the OBD2 adapter.
- Pair your smartphone with the adapter.
- Open the OBD2 app and follow the instructions to connect to the adapter.
6. Understanding Diagnostic Trouble Codes (DTCs)
6.1 What are DTCs?
Diagnostic Trouble Codes (DTCs) are codes stored by the OBD2 system when it detects a problem. Each code corresponds to a specific issue or component.
6.2 Common DTCs and Their Meanings
Some common DTCs include:
- P0300: Random/Multiple Cylinder Misfire Detected
- P0171: System Too Lean (Bank 1)
- P0420: Catalyst System Efficiency Below Threshold (Bank 1)
- P0101: Mass Air Flow Circuit Range/Performance Problem
6.3 How to Interpret DTCs
OBD2 apps typically provide a brief description of each DTC. However, it’s essential to consult a repair manual or online resources for more detailed information and troubleshooting steps.
7. Advanced OBD2 App Features
7.1 Custom PIDs
Custom PIDs (Parameter IDs) allow you to access manufacturer-specific data that is not part of the standard OBD2 protocol. This can be useful for monitoring parameters like transmission temperature or individual cylinder misfires.
7.2 Data Logging
Data logging allows you to record sensor data over time, which can be helpful for diagnosing intermittent issues or tracking performance improvements after repairs.
7.3 Performance Monitoring
Some OBD2 apps offer performance monitoring features, such as:
- 0-60 mph timers
- Quarter-mile timers
- Horsepower and torque estimates
These features can be fun for enthusiasts and useful for tracking modifications.

15. OBD2 App Free for Specific Car Brands
15.1 BMW: Carly
Carly is a popular OBD2 app specifically designed for BMW vehicles. It offers advanced diagnostics, coding, and maintenance features.
15.2 Ford: FORScan
FORScan is a powerful OBD2 app for Ford, Lincoln, and Mercury vehicles. It provides access to manufacturer-specific diagnostics and programming functions.
15.3 GM: GM MDI
GM MDI (Multiple Diagnostic Interface) is a professional-grade diagnostic tool for GM vehicles. While it’s not a standalone app, it can be used with a laptop and compatible OBD2 adapter.
15.4 Toyota: Techstream
Techstream is Toyota’s official diagnostic software. It requires a laptop and compatible OBD2 adapter but provides comprehensive diagnostics and programming capabilities.
15.5 VAG (Volkswagen Audi Group): VCDS
VCDS (VAG-COM Diagnostic System) is a popular diagnostic tool for Volkswagen, Audi, Skoda, and Seat vehicles. It offers advanced diagnostics, coding, and adaptation features.

17. Case Studies: Real-World Examples
17.1 Identifying a Misfire
An OBD2 app can help you identify a misfire by displaying DTCs like P0300 (Random/Multiple Cylinder Misfire Detected) and P0301-P0308 (specific cylinder misfires).
17.2 Diagnosing a Lean Condition
An OBD2 app can help you diagnose a lean condition by displaying DTCs like P0171 (System Too Lean – Bank 1) and P0174 (System Too Lean – Bank 2).
17.3 Monitoring Fuel Efficiency
An OBD2 app can help you monitor fuel efficiency by displaying real-time MPG (miles per gallon) data and tracking fuel consumption over time.

What is the difference between OBD1 and OBD2?
OBD1 is an older, less standardized system used in vehicles before 1996, while OBD2 is a standardized system used in most vehicles since 1996 to monitor engine performance, emissions, and other critical systems.
Do all cars have an OBD2 port?
Most vehicles manufactured after 1996 have an OBD2 port, typically located under the dashboard.
How do I find my car’s OBD2 port?
The OBD2 port is usually located under the dashboard on the driver’s side. Consult your car’s owner’s manual for the exact location.
What is a DTC code?
A DTC (Diagnostic Trouble Code) is a code stored by the OBD2 system when it detects a problem. Each code corresponds to a specific issue or component.
Can an OBD2 scanner turn off the check engine light?
Yes, an OBD2 scanner can clear diagnostic trouble codes (DTCs) and turn off the check engine light. However, the light may come back on if the underlying issue is not resolved.
Is it safe to clear DTC codes without fixing the problem?
Clearing DTC codes without fixing the underlying problem is not recommended. The check engine light will likely come back on, and you may be masking a more serious issue.
